Aram Zobian is an American professional poker player known for his aggressive style and online achievements. He has made multiple final tables in major events such as the WSOP and has accumulated prize money in high-stakes tournaments.

Player Overview

Aram Zobian was born in the United States and showed talent quickly after being introduced to poker at a young age. He is active in both online and live poker circles, known for his high-pressure style and strategic depth, and is considered one of the pillars of contemporary poker.

Career and Major Achievements

Zobian has achieved excellent results in numerous world-class events, including final table appearances at the WSOP and EPT series. He won a WPT Main Event side event championship and has been consistently profitable in online high-stakes games. Public records do not list all his titles, but industry consensus regards him as a consistently stable player.

Playing Style

A typical aggressive player: frequent raising and bluffing, adept at using position and board texture to apply pressure. Post-flop, he excels at building large pots while possessing a solid foundation in mathematical calculations, pursuing long-term positive expected value amidst variance.
